Aparta-Hotel Melihah, with the category of 2 stars, consists of 6 apartments all different. It is located in the heart of the medieval city of Daroca (2.200 inhabitants) on the corner of the main street (Europe's largest medieval street) and the Plaza de Santiago, the nerve center of all kinds of activities. They have excellent views.

The house dates from the seventeenth century and has been completely renovated while retaining all the elements of architectural interest, decorative, wooden beams, revolts, stone walls, solid brick, wrought iron, antique furniture, etc. and at the same time, incorporating the comforts of today in day, elevator, bathrooms with hydromassage columns, etc. so that our guests find all the comfort they want.

The building consists of six apartments: Zayda, Amira, Melihah and Halima, named after Arab princesses from the medieval past of Daroca, alluding to the decorative style that has been given to these apartments. Daroca is a medieval city surrounded by 4 km of walls, with an old town full of monuments, museums and palaces of Romanesque, Mudejar, Gothic style, etc. known in antiquity as the pearl of Jiloca. City never conquered, "Porta Férrea", where they coexisted in peace during many centuries Jews, Muslims and Christians, with remains of the three cultures. The year 2016 marks the 650th anniversary of the appointment of Daroca as CITY by King Pedro IV the Ceremonious, due to his many merits and his courageous defense in the "War of the two Pedros" against the Castilian troops led by King Pedro I the Cruel, of Castile.

Daroca is a strategic place well communicated to see the natural beauties of a large area located both in the province of Zaragoza and Teruel. This is due to its excellent location, less than an hour from the two provincial capitals, through the Mudejar A-23 motorway.
